X-Git-Url: https://jfr.im/git/erebus.git/blobdiff_plain/30e3843de07b9c4e6ca6e92fcae715d28ac2a39e..d6fe4b48cfb9f76ad862b6948ee1f24e892b4021:/modules/eval.py diff --git a/modules/eval.py b/modules/eval.py index 5ac60fd..6e19282 100644 --- a/modules/eval.py +++ b/modules/eval.py @@ -18,8 +18,8 @@ modstop = lib.modstop # module code import sys - @lib.hook('eval', needchan=False, glevel=lib.MANAGER) +@lib.argsGE(1) def cmd_eval(bot, user, chan, realtarget, *args): if chan is not None: replyto = chan else: replyto = user @@ -30,6 +30,7 @@ def cmd_eval(bot, user, chan, realtarget, *args): @lib.hook('exec', needchan=False, glevel=lib.MANAGER) +@lib.argsGE(1) def cmd_exec(bot, user, chan, realtarget, *args): if chan is not None: replyto = chan else: replyto = user